Just a thought after Christmas shall we have a sizzix die swop???

This is how it would work.

Basically you cut 50 sizzix die cuts that you have and then send them on to me with an SAE.

I will then sort out all the packs and send you die cuts that you dont have.

You would need to email me a list of dies that you have so you dont get duplicates and also a preference of colours that you would like.

I will send out emails to all that are taking part and give a list of colours, dies etc that people are short of.

This will take ages to sort out so bear with me!!!

Can all those who want to take part sign up by 5th Jan (if we get 10 names before this date then the swop will start earlier)

Emails to confirm the dies you have should be

sent to

jayzmummy at yahoo dot co dot uk

by 5th Jan

If anyone wants to take part in this swop, who does not have a sizzix then they are more than welcome, but they would need to send 10 packs of assorted fibres....each pack containing 4, three meter lengths of funky fibres (buy four assorted balls of wool and cut it into 10x 3 metre lengths, so each of the 10 bags would then contain 12 meteres of fibre)Does that make sense????

This swop would be open to the first 10 that join up. You will all recieve back a parcel which will contain an assortment of 50 die cuts and a pack of funky fibres.

All dies/fibres will need to be cut and posted by 20th Jan for the completion of the swop by 27th Jan.

ALPHABETS ARE NOT INCLUDED IN THIS SWOP.

PS Does anyone know what to do when a die jams in a sidekick? It won't go forward or back and I can't budge it. It was my first play with it (It was a Chrimbo pressie!) I'm gutted!

UCM · 18/01/2006 00:22

If you lift the plastic base, there are two screws that tighten the rollers, could you loosen them and see if that works.

JayzMummy · 18/01/2006 01:24

There have been some problems with the sidekick....a faulty batch???...AQ had a faulty one and my neighbours has just packed up....the dies are getting jammed...take it back to the shop you bought it from....they should exchange it.

Dingle · 19/01/2006 13:00

Your best bet is to go to a wool shop, as in knitting yarns as opposed to "fibres" sold by the meter. That way you can pick up something like this which is a couple of £ for 90 metres.
